Furiosa: A Mad Max Saga hasn’t hit theaters yet, but its director, George Miller, has already been spitballing ideas for the character’s next chapter in the franchise. Starring Anya Taylor-Joy as the eponymous heroine, Furiosa is a prequel to 2015’s Mad Max: Fury Road, and shows her journey from a child of the ‘Green Place’ to the shaved-headed killer audiences adored in Miller’s long-awaited return to the franchise. After introducing the character in Fury Road and exploring her backstory in Furiosa, George Miller started turning his attention towards the character’s future, and where she goes after her run in with ‘Mad’ Max Rockatansky (Tom Hardy).

Speaking to Total Film at Furiosa’s London premiere, George Miller revealed he’d started conceptualizing the character’s future, which could lead to a new movie. Miller revealed that he frequently thinks about Furiosa’s whereabouts following Fury Road, and is excited by the prospect of how she handles power after defeating Immortan Joe (Hugh Keayes-Byrne). Miller said:

“I’ve often speculated when we see Furiosa go up to the Citadel on that platform at the very end [of Fury Road] and nod goodbye to Max who wanders to the Wasteland… I often think: ‘What does she do, sitting up at the top of the dominant hierarchy? Does she fall into the trap that most revolutionaries do? You know, yesterday’s hero becomes tomorrow’s tyrant, which is classic in storytelling.”

Furiosa & Fury Road Are One ‘Long, Extended Movie’

Directors often have a preference as to how their movies are watched, as much as they might deny it (don’t tell Christopher Nolan you watched Oppenheimer on your Smart Fridge, though he’s okay with phones now). During his interview, Miller revealed an exciting way to watch Furiosa, stating audiences should try and view Furiosa as a direct double feature with Mad Max: Fury Road. Furiosa explores the character’s adolescence and young adult years, and Miller crafted the film to link directly to the beginning of Fury Road.

“I’m very lucky to say that the two films kind of joined together. You can almost play them as a long, extended movie,” Miller said.

The director then revealed his reasoning for exploring that era of Furiosa’s character. The director said it came down to simple interest, believing her time as a rebellious teenager is far more exciting than her childhood spent in the utopian ‘Green Place.’ Miller said:

“I’m not interested in Furiosa from when she’s playing in the Green Place from the age zero to 10 [laughs]. Collecting peaches, and swimming, and learning to climb, and figuring out what a motorbike is even though there’s no gasoline, and so on.”

Alongside Taylor-Joy, Furiosa also stars Chris Hemsworth as Dementus, a vile warlord, whom the actor has described as “a pretty horrible individual.” The first reaction are already out for Furiosa, following its premiere, and the film is certified fresh at 86% on Rotten Tomatoes – with many outlets giving the film perfect 5/5 (and 10/10) reviews.
